Arrest made after crash leaves mother dead, teens with broken legs as they were on their way to school

The crash left a “dedicated, supportive” mother dead, according to Lucy Adame-Clark with Bexar County.

SAN ANTONIO — The Bexar County Sheriff’s Office confirmed that a mother is dead and two teenagers left with broken legs following a crash near the El Carmen Catholic Church – Losoya.

Around 6:30 a.m. on Monday, BCSO responded to the 1700 block of Martinez Losoya after receiving reports of a two-vehicle crash that had taken place. Authorities said the crash involving a minivan and a pickup truck left a woman dead, along with a 13- and 14-year-old each sustaining their injuries. 

The teens have reportedly been released from the hospital.

The suspect, who has been identified as 28-year-old Jose Alfredo Nino Lopez, has been arrested and is facing charges of manslaughter, injury to child and aggravated assault causing serious bodily injury.

Bexar County Clerk Lucy Adame-Clark went to Facebook to speak about the deceased mother, identified as Crystal Mendoza, and the impact she had on the community and her family.

“Today, our SISD community and Southside FFA family lost a very dedicated, supportive and amazing mother, Crystal Mendoza to her family,” said Adame-Clark. “She was involved in this horrific accident with her family this morning in front of El Carmen Catholic Church – Losoya that took Crystal’s life. Prayers to the family, friends and our community.”
